University of New Haven

West Haven, CT

Our analysis found University of New Haven to be the best school for taxation students who want to pursue a master’s degree in Connecticut. University of New Haven is a moderately-sized private not-for-profit school located in the suburb of West Haven.

Taxation majors at University of New Haven take out an average of $31,278 in student loans while working on their Master's Degree.
